Standup comedian Dave Chappelle says he is ‘fully cooperating’ with Los Angeles police after he was tackled during a show at the Hollywood Bowl on Monday.
Chappelle was on stage as part of the ‘Netflix is a Joke’ festival when 23 year old Isaiah Lee of Los Angeles rushed the stage carrying a replica handgun with a knife inside of it.
He was knocked over by Lee and moments later the man was tackled by actor Jamie Foxx who was watching Chappelle’s show from the wings.
Lee was apparently injured while being subdued by security and was shown being loaded into an ambulance with facial injuries.

Chappelle was not injured in the attack.
Comedian Chris Rock, who was in attendance, later appeared on stage and asked the crowd “was that Will Smith?” a reference to the Oscar winner slapping him over a joke about Jada Pinkett Smith at the Academy Awards last month.
The show continued without incident, though no motive for Lee’s attack has been established.
